Complete the steps to solve the inequality:

0.2(x + 20) – 3 > –7 – 6.2x

Use the distributive property:
Combine like terms:
Use the addition property of inequality:
Use the subtraction property of inequality:
Use the division property of inequality:




0.2x + 4 – 3 > –7 – 6.2x

0.2x + 1 > –7 – 6.2x

6.4x + 1 > –7

6.4x > –8
